πŸ”΄ πŸ’¬ I developed a 270 million parameter language model entirely from scratch as an independent research project β€” score 75 Sources: reddit/r/LocalLLaMA

The model is built on a custom Transformer architecture featuring Rotary Positional Embeddings, RMSNorm, SwiGLU feed forward layers, grouped query attention, and an efficient autoregressive decoder optimized for local inference.
